“If others tell us something we make assumptions, and if they don't tell us something we make assumptions to fulfill our need to know and to replace the need to communicate. Even if we hear something and we don't understand we make assumptions about what it means and then believe the assumptions. We make all sorts of assumptions because we don't have the courage to ask questions.”

Anonymous

About This Quote

People fill gaps in understanding with assumptions, especially when communication is unclear or absent, often avoiding direct inquiry.

In simple terms: We assume things instead of asking questions.
